Using the result of the previous exercise, calculate the skin depthλ = 1/kI for the penetration of an electromagnetic wave into a metal surface, as a function of frequency and the material parameters n (the electron density), m (the electron mass) and τ (the average electron scattering time). For realistic parameters for a metal, that is, n = N/V = 1021 cm−3 and τ = 1 ps, what is the skin depth of a 10 MHz electromagnetic wave?
